In India, Burma/Myanmar, Nepal, Sri Lanka and other parts of South and South East Asia, the leaves are chewed together in a wrapped package along with the areca nut (which, by association, is often inaccurately called ‘betel nut’) and mineral slaked lime (calcium hydroxide). Betel leaves are used as a stimulant, an antiseptic and breath-freshener.
